In today's episode, Tom and I are talking about how we've navigated expectations in ranch life and marriage. We've learned that unspoken expectations are resentments waiting to happen. If you're going to have an expectation about XYZ, you've got to speak it - not everyone is going to have the same expectation or understand where you're coming from! 

We hope this episode gives you a more REAL insight into how we've navigated expectations in ranch life and marriage. We've both done the inner work on our own (as well as together); it takes time to get there, but it's absolutely worth it.

Remember - speaking expectations are so, SO important. People aren't mind readers, and they can't meet expectations they don't know exist! 

In this episode, we cover:

  • Tom’s experience with having high, unspoken expectations of others + how that’s changed
  • What to consider if your expectations are consistently NOT being met
  • The correlation between feeling safe & effectively communicating your expectations
  • Making sure that YOU’RE in the right place mentally in order to help others
